Cis transport integration as a factor of sustainable mobility
The article deals with topical issues of development of integration processes in the field of transportation within the CIS. Currently, both integration and disintegration trends are observed within the CIS. At the same time, the transport and logistics sphere is the key for the realization of the integration potential of any economic association of states. In complex current geopolitical conditions, when regional-bloc cooperation becomes the most promising form of international cooperation, preservation of historically established ties within the CIS is important for the stable development not only of Russia, but also of other member states. The existing strategy of convergence of transport systems to create a common transport space within the CIS requires actualization taking into account new geopolitical realities and a program-targeted approach to its formation.
Sustainable transport: Main trends in Russia-China cooperation
The article discusses the main issues of implementing sustainable transport concept in Eurasian region as trend in Russia – China cooperation, especially on railway transport. Digitalization of the transport industry, use of Industry 4.0 technology became main drivers of transport and infrastructure ecosystem development. But at the current stage it is a way to provide for sustainable transport policy realization. Russia – China cooperation in transport and logistics has its issues, especially in the field of legal regulation, it is tough to broaden technologies of Industry 4.0 implementation. Rules of technical exploitation on railway do not provide for safe use of such technology on current intellectual transport ecosystems. Sustainable transport conception needs creation of regional experiment- based type of legal rules, designed in the frames of such integrational unions as EAEU - China. At the current stage of IT services on transport regulation Chinese and European legislation can be used as a model. Without effective legislative framework for sustainable transport cooperation with China transport ecosystems competitiveness of Russian railroad industry could not be grown to provide for national technological sovereignty.
Biodegradable Cell Microcarriers Based on Chitosan/Polyester Graft-Copolymers
Self-stabilizing biodegradable microcarriers were produced via an oil/water solvent evaporation technique using amphiphilic chitosan-g-polyester copolymers as a core material in oil phase without the addition of any emulsifier in aqueous phase. The total yield of the copolymer-based microparticles reached up to 79 wt. %, which is comparable to a yield achievable using traditional emulsifiers. The kinetics of microparticle self-stabilization, monitored during their process, were correlated to the migration of hydrophilic copolymer’s moieties to the oil/water interface. With a favorable surface/volume ratio and the presence of bioadhesive natural fragments anchored to their surface, the performance of these novel microcarriers has been highlighted by evaluating cell morphology and proliferation within a week of cell cultivation in vitro.
Peculiarity and functionality of the digital educational ecosystem for transport and logistics
The article presents the results and interpretation thereof of a study of the transport education transformation as a digital educational ecosystem in the context of the global digitalization processes, the strategy of the state, intellectual priorities for transport and logistics, the market demands. Certain potential innovative forms of modern education are suggested, namely the combined use of university educational resources and employer’s materials and technical resources. They are studied on the example of the first Russian transport engineering higher education institution, Emperor Alexander I St. Petersburg State Transport University (PGUPS), where their ongoing implementations are called ‘Innovative site for international educational programmes of proactive training of high-speed railway personnel’, ‘Network University’.

Digital logistics platforms as a current trend to ensure the transport competitiveness of the state on the example of China's LOGINK platform
The article discusses current trends in the development of digital logistics platforms, changes in international legal regulation of the transport and logistics industry to create a regulatory framework governing the functioning of logistics platforms, China's experience in creating a logistics platform LOGINK, as well as the impact of digitalization processes and anti-globalization sentiment in the global economy on the formation of new trends in the regulation of cross-border logistics. The analysis of Chinese experience in creating an international digital logistics platform LOGINK allows us to identify best practices and adopt successful experience of digitalization of cross-border logistics to increase the resilience of the Russian transport and logistics ec to external geopolitical challenges and the formation of a digital logistics ecosystem within the EAEU. In the context of digitalization and automation of processes, the rupture of Russian-European logistics routes, strengthening of international cooperation in the Asia-Pacific region, modernization of international legal regulation of transport and logistics cooperation is required in order to create and implement a unified digital platform to fully ensure the 5th level logistics provider, to create a standard of international electronic document management and electronic consignment note.
